Indigenous Women Making Traditional Culture Relevant

Walnut Creek Wetland Center 950 Peterson St, Raleigh

During this free panel, Small Island Big Song artists and Charly Lowry (Lumbee/Tuscarora) will share their experiences as performers and cultural ambassadors. They will discuss the roles women have traditionally played in their respective cultures and discuss different ways in which they have found support and risen above challenges to realize their potential as artists and leaders in their communities.
